8 Bible Verses about Bears
Most Relevant Verses
And David said unto Saul, Your servant kept his father's sheep, and there came a lion, and a bear, and took a lamb out of the flock:
For, said Hushai, you know your father and his men, that they are mighty men, and they are chafed in their minds, as a bear robbed of her whelps in the field: and your father is a man of war, and will not lodge with the people.
Let a bear robbed of her whelps meet a man, rather than a fool in his folly.
As a roaring lion, and a charging bear; so is a wicked ruler over the poor people.
And behold another beast, a second, like a bear, and it raised up itself on one side, and it had three ribs in its mouth between its teeth: and they said thus unto it, Arise, devour much flesh.
And the beast that I saw was like unto a leopard, and his feet were as the feet of a bear, and his mouth as the mouth of a lion: and the dragon gave him his power, and his throne, and great authority.
And the cow and the bear shall feed; their young ones shall lie down together: and the lion shall eat straw like the ox.
